The FS1023-DL comprise a MEMS flow sensor mounted on a circuit board with an amplification circuit and a flow housing.
The FS1023-DL is targeted for liquid applications. The sensor utilizes thermopile sensing, which provides an excellent signal-to-noise ratio and is ideal for applications requiring low power. It is highly sensitive at low flow rates with a very fast response time.The FS1023-DL outputs a non-linear curve with flow. It features an Analog, 0 to 4.5V, and Digital I2C output.
FS1023-DL complies with NSF/ANSI 61: Drinking Water Systems Components - Health Effects. It can be safely used in water and beverage applications.
